About this course

Engineers must make critical decisions in the face of uncertainty, from assessing structural safety to modeling environmental risks. Understanding the mathematical foundation of probability is the key to predicting outcomes and designing resilient systems. This course guides you from basic definitions to advanced probability theorems, helping you build a solid analytical framework. Through clear written explanations and practical engineering-focused examples, you will transition from intuitive guessing to rigorous mathematical calculation. You will learn to break down complex systems into manageable events and calculate their likelihoods with precision. What you'll learn: - Define foundational probability concepts and the mathematical axioms governing events - Perform operations on events including unions, intersections, and complements - Apply properties of events to simplify complex engineering probability problems - Calculate conditional probabilities to update risk assessments as new data arrives - Utilize the Total Probability Theorem and Bayes' theorem to analyze multi-stage systems - Model real-world engineering uncertainties using modern statistical concepts This course begins with essential terminology, establishing a clear understanding of sample spaces and set theory before moving into practical probability calculations. You will progress systematically through independent events, conditional scenarios, and systemic probability modeling. This course is designed for engineering students, practicing technical professionals, and anyone seeking a structured, beginner-friendly introduction to probability theory.
